On 09/25/2025 at 11:25 AM,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) Janie Davis met with Facility Representative (RP) Denise Espitia for the purpose of an unannounced annual inspection, and Licensee guided LPA on a tour of the home. LPA observed five children present in the home with RP. Licensee's operating hours are Monday through Sunday from 6:00 AM to 6:00 PM. LPA discussed annual fees. Facility PIN and fee amount was provided($210.00) All individuals subject to a criminal record review have obtained a criminal record clearance. Licensee was reminded that all adults 18 and over living or working in the home, including employees and volunteers, except as specified in Health and Safety Code section 1596.871, must obtain a criminal record clearance or exemption, or transfer their existing clearance or exemption, prior to initial presence in a licensed Family Child Care Home. A civil penalty of $100.00 minimum/day for a maximum of five days or, if the penalty is for a repeat violation, for a maximum of 30 days per person will be assessed if this regulation is violated. LPA reviewed five children's files, and LPA discussed the necessity for emergency information and required immunization records to be on file. LPA discussed a current roster. LPA discussed the requirement to conduct and document fire and disaster drills at least once every six months. LPA verified Licensee's immunization records were available in the facility file. LPA reviewed required immunizations for all employees and volunteers. LPA verified mandated reporter training requirement and informed Licensee that certifications are to be AB1207 compliant. Certification expires 11/15/2025 Licensee was reminded to renew the course every two years. Current EMSA pediatric CPR and first aid certification were discussed and expired on 02/18/2025 . Licensee was informed of the MyChildCarePlan.org site, a consumer education website that helps families obtain child care by connecting them to child care providers and Resource and Referral Agencies (R&Rs) throughout California. Because Licensee rents/leases the home, proof of landlord notification is required. LPA observed the Property Owner/Landlord Notification form (LIC 9151) that Licensee confirms was provided to the property owner/landlord. Licensee obtained a signed Property Owner/Landlord Consent Form (LIC 9149). Based on LPA\342\200\231s observations, interviews conducted, and records reviewed, deficiencies are being cited on the attached LIC 809-D. LPA Janie Davis informed the RP, Denise Espitia that this report dated 09/25/25 documents three Type B citations as there were potential risks to the health, safety, or personal rights of children in care. As well as one type A citation as there were regulatory violations that posed immediate danger to children in care. For type A citations parents of children present are required to sign form LIC9227 and keep a copy in the child's file for three years. All families enrolling into the facility for the next 12 months will also be requried to sign form LIC9227 and keep a copy in said child's file for three years. An exit interview was conducted and report was reviewed with the RP, Denise Espitia During the exit interview, Licensee confirmed that there are no registered sex offenders (RSO) living in the facility and LPA completed the RSO profile in the Field Automation System. A notice of site visit was given to Licensee and must remain posted on, or immediately adjacent to, the interior side of the main door for 30 days. Failure to comply with posting requirements shall result in an immediate civil penalty of $100.

What does Type A vs Type B mean?

Type A. Serious citation. Imminent or substantial risk to children. The regulator requires corrective action immediately and may impose a civil penalty.

Type B. Lower-severity citation. Corrective action required, no imminent risk. The regulator monitors compliance on the next visit.
